I have a 1099-R with state tax withheld that is greater than the state distribution. I am getting an error indicating that I cannot e-file my state return like this.

Box 14 is blank on almost all 1099-R forms...

Quick fix.....Edit the 1099-R in the Federal section and if box 2a has a real value in it (not zero and not blank) enter the box 2a value into box 14.  then step thru the remaining pages to make sure all questions are answered properly.

If box 2a is empty, you probably need to put in the federally-taxable amount of box 1 into box 14.  if you know that it is all taxable, then box 1 will do
________________________
For my state (NC), when I go thru the 1099-R entries, I leave box 14 empty...but when I step thru the questions following the main page, the software back-fills the box 14 software form with the value of box 2a.   If you never went thru those followup questions, then that may be why box 14 is empty on your software 1099-R form .  The state distribution amount (box 14) is rarely-to-never actually a zero in the software.
